The Role of Mandatory Independent Audits
One of the primary pillars of modern gaming regulation involves the certification of random number generators and core gaming mechanics. Licensing bodies require operators to subject their technical infrastructure to routine evaluations conducted by approved testing agencies. These rigorous assessments confirm that the digital systems remain free from internal bias or external interference.
Furthermore, these compliance audits verify that advertised payout structures align precisely with real-world outcomes over prolonged periods. Regular public disclosure of these results reinforces transparency and builds long-term confidence among participants. Enforcing Transparency in Operational Mathematics
Legitimate legal frameworks dictate that operators must clearly publish the underlying odds and payout metrics for all available options. Providing clear mathematical information enables individuals to make fully informed decisions before engaging with any platform. This proactive measure eliminates deceptive marketing practices that could otherwise mislead the public regarding their actual chances.
Regulatory authorities also enforce strict rules against abrupt changes to operational parameters without prior formal notification. Any adjustment to performance metrics must undergo strict regulatory approval processes before implementation on active digital platforms. This bureaucratic oversight ensures that operators maintain stable environments that respect consumer rights consistently.
Consumer Protection and Dispute Resolution
Fairness extends beyond technical algorithms to include the structural processing of financial transactions and player balances. Modern legislation establishes clear operational mandates regarding the segregation of operational funds from consumer deposits. This financial separation guarantees that player balances remain fully protected even during institutional hardships.
Additionally, regulatory frameworks provide standardized paths for handling consumer grievances through formal independent arbitration systems. When conflicts arise regarding specific payouts or account status, participants can seek resolution outside the operator's corporate structure. These neutral avenues ensure that consumer claims receive impartial evaluations based strictly on established legal codes.
Mitigating Market Manipulation and Collusion
Advanced legal guidelines require digital platforms to employ sophisticated monitoring tools designed to detect anomalous behavior patterns. Security teams look for indicators of insider activity, syndicated bot rings, or illicit software deployment that compromises natural integrity. Catching these fraudulent activities early prevents bad actors from gaining unfair advantages over standard participants.
Strict penalties await organizations or individuals found guilty of violating these competitive integrity standards worldwide. Enforcement measures often range from substantial financial administrative fines to the complete revocation of operating licenses. These severe consequences demonstrate the global commitment to preserving honest environments across all legitimate digital markets.
Fostering Accountability Through Licensing Systems
Comprehensive licensing frameworks establish the fundamental ground rules that distinguish equitable platforms from predatory underground entities. Operators must demonstrate extensive financial liquidity and undergo thorough background checks before receiving legal authorization. These structural prerequisites filter out unstable entities and ensure that only responsible corporations enter the active market.
